About The Position

Case Manager (CM), RN, Rehabilitation at Blanchard Valley Hospital is a full-time position within Lifepoint Rehabilitation, which is part of Lifepoint Health. This role is dedicated to making communities healthier by providing exceptional care. The Case Manager will interview and assess patients and/or their families, determine and arrange for needed services, participate in case reviews, consult with healthcare team members on treatment plans, and assist with discharge planning. This includes identifying and referring patients to appropriate resources such as transportation, housing, healthcare, and social/spiritual services. The role also involves performing Medicaid screenings and assisting patients with Safety Net applications.
